Parts of Church Street are to be closed at night as the new look pavements are finished.
AdvertisementFrom St John’s Place (the street where Warehouse is) to Lancaster Road (so corner with Baluga) is shut off overnight.
The first set of work takes place from Sunday 21 August until Friday 26 August with the closure from 10pm to 6am.
A second stage of works is from Tuesday 30 August to Thursday 1 September.
The second stage sees the closure extended from Thursday 25 August up to where Fishergate and Church Street meet.

County Councillor Jennifer Mein, leader of the county council, said: “These city centre improvements will help to bring in new businesses and attract more people to this part of the city.
“Working in such a busy area will cause some disruption, but we’ve been focused on keeping this to a minimum throughout the scheme, while making sure that people can continue to access businesses.
“I’m sure that people will be happy when they see the completed improvements. We’re looking forward to seeing the benefits that it brings to this part of the city centre.”
Diversions during the closure are being put in place and alternative bus stops are to be used.
